C# Class Executor.Executor

Inheritance: System.MarshalByRefObject, IExecutor
Datei anzeigen Open project: kennystone/quickfixn Class Usage Examples

Public Methods

Method Description
FromAdmin ( Contracts.Message message, SessionID sessionID ) : void
FromApp ( Contracts.Message message, SessionID sessionID ) : void
OnCreate ( SessionID sessionID ) : void
OnLogon ( SessionID sessionID ) : void
OnLogout ( SessionID sessionID ) : void
OnMessage ( QuickFix n, SessionID s ) : void
ToAdmin ( Contracts.Message message, SessionID sessionID ) : void
ToApp ( Contracts.Message message, SessionID sessionID ) : void

Private Methods

Method Description
GenExecID ( ) : string
GenOrderID ( ) : string

Method Details

FromAdmin() public method

public FromAdmin ( Contracts.Message message, SessionID sessionID ) : void
message Contracts.Message
sessionID SessionID
return void

FromApp() public method

public FromApp ( Contracts.Message message, SessionID sessionID ) : void
message Contracts.Message
sessionID SessionID
return void

OnCreate() public method

public OnCreate ( SessionID sessionID ) : void
sessionID SessionID
return void

OnLogon() public method

public OnLogon ( SessionID sessionID ) : void
sessionID SessionID
return void

OnLogout() public method

public OnLogout ( SessionID sessionID ) : void
sessionID SessionID
return void

OnMessage() public method

public OnMessage ( QuickFix n, SessionID s ) : void
n QuickFix
s SessionID
return void

ToAdmin() public method

public ToAdmin ( Contracts.Message message, SessionID sessionID ) : void
message Contracts.Message
sessionID SessionID
return void

ToApp() public method

public ToApp ( Contracts.Message message, SessionID sessionID ) : void
message Contracts.Message
sessionID SessionID
return void